摘要

In recent times, a lot of development has taken place in deep learning, as a result of which development in smart healthcare applications has increased to a great extent. It successfully improved clinical institutions’ quality of care through data-driven insight. Strong data-drivenness underpins excellent deep learning models. The performance of such a model gets more reliable and generalizable as more data is trained on it. To train a model, the physiological information of the patient must be kept in a large storage area, which presents challenges related to privacy, ownership, and stringent regulations. Federated learning overcomes the aforementioned difficulties by using a shared central server as well as a deep learning model. The local party still has access to patient data, maintaining the security and anonymity of the information. In this study, we first give a thorough, current overview of the federated learning research that has been done in healthcare applications. We also discussed the difficulties, approaches, and applications of federated learning that a practitioner should be aware of.
